The word "breaker" has several synonyms that can be used interchangeably. One of them is "smasher", meaning something that breaks or crushes something else. Another synonym for breaker is "disrupter", which is often used to describe something or someone that interrupts or disturbs the regular flow of things. "Demolisher" is another synonym, referring to something that destroys or takes apart something else. "Rupturer" is a less commonly used synonym, but it means to break or rupture something. Finally, "shatterer" can also be used as a synonym for breaker, implying that something is being destroyed or shattered into pieces.
